]> git.mxchange.org Git - simgear.git/blobdiff - simgear/io/SVNReportParser.cxx
Drop explicit SDK setting on Mac
[simgear.git] / simgear / io / SVNReportParser.cxx
index d31d32763bbd61784f16056b4a62870ba219281e..72b6169310338b65a3a07800f7feca5c3671dbf2 100644 (file)
@@ -377,8 +377,9 @@ public:
     memset(&md5Context, 0, sizeof(SG_MD5_CTX));
     SG_MD5Init(&md5Context);
     SG_MD5Update(&md5Context, (unsigned char*) output.data(), output.size());
-    SG_MD5Final(&md5Context);
-    decodedFileMd5 = strutils::encodeHex(md5Context.digest, 16);
+    unsigned char digest[MD5_DIGEST_LENGTH];
+    SG_MD5Final(digest, &md5Context);
+    decodedFileMd5 = strutils::encodeHex(digest, MD5_DIGEST_LENGTH);
 
     return true;
   }